Output 308a7863db7ac76ccd3758948d6e90d98bea12ecb89eb4593f620cebbd9a78c5:0

value
18809013
script pubkey
OP_0 OP_PUSHBYTES_20 85f36fb400214e352568e69dddfc39ffc4bbfe18
address
bc1qshekldqqy98r2ftgu6wamlpellzthlsccrs0p2
transaction
308a7863db7ac76ccd3758948d6e90d98bea12ecb89eb4593f620cebbd9a78c5
spent
true